Inround Innovations, Phone Number 613-725-3701, +1 6137253701, Address 190 Maclaren St # 204, City Ottawa ON, Postal Code K2P 0L6 Canada
Download vCard or use the Inround Innovations QR Code. Inround Innovations area of business is Business Management Consultants.